Short Description: The Drupal Web Developer is responsible for designing, developing, maintaining, and enhancing web applications and digital platforms built on the latest versions of Drupal (Drupal 9/10/11). Complete Description: The Drupal Web Developer is responsible for designing, developing, maintaining, and enhancing web applications and digital platforms built on the latest versions of Drupal (Drupal 9/10/11). This role ensures high‑quality, secure, scalable, and user‑centered digital experiences that support organizational goals. The developer collaborates closely with designers, content teams, product owners, and IT leadership to deliver modern, accessible, and high‑performing web solutions. Key Responsibilities Drupal Development & Architecture - Develop, configure, and maintain websites using the latest versions of Drupal (9/10/11). - Build custom modules, themes, and integrations following Drupal best practices. - Implement and maintain content types, views, taxonomies, blocks, and menus. - Ensure code quality through version control, peer reviews, and adherence to coding standards (Drupal Coding Standards, PSR‑4, Composer workflows). Site Maintenance & Enhancements - Perform regular updates, security patches, and module upgrades. - Troubleshoot and resolve site issues, performance bottlenecks, and compatibility problems. - Optimize websites for speed, accessibility (WCAG 2.1+), SEO, and mobile responsiveness. - Maintain documentation for configurations, custom code, and deployment processes. Integration & API Development - Build and maintain integrations with third‑party systems (REST, API, GraphQL, SSO, CRM, payment gateways, etc.). - Work with cloud hosting environments (Acquia, Pantheon, AWS, Azure) to deploy and manage Drupal applications. - Implement CI/CD pipelines for automated testing and deployments. Collaboration & Project Support - Work closely with UX/UI designers to implement modern, user‑friendly interfaces. - Partner with content editors to improve workflows, permissions, and editorial experience. - Participate in Agile ceremonies (sprint planning, standups, retrospectives). - Provide technical guidance and recommendations to stakeholders and leadership. Required Qualifications -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Systems, or related field (or equivalent experience). - 3–5+ years of experience developing with Drupal (including Drupal 9/10/11). - Strong proficiency in PHP, Twig, H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, and responsive design. - Experience with Composer, Drush, Git, and modern development workflows. - Knowledge of MySQL/MariaDB and database optimization. - Experience with cloud hosting platforms (Acquia, Pantheon, AWS, Azure). - Understanding of web accessibility standards (WCAG), security best practices, and performance optimization. Preferred Qualifications - Experience with headless or decoupled Drupal architectures. - Familiarity with React, Vue, or other modern JavaScript frameworks. - Experience with Docker or containerized development environments. - Acquia Drupal Developer or Site Builder certification. - Experience working in Agile/Scrum environments.
